Timex Dynabeat Watches
The Timex Dynabeat watches are an upgrade from the previous generation of Electric watches. They have a high-beat movement increasing from 21,600 Bph to 28,800 Bph which gives the seconds hand a smoother sweeping action.
Timex Dynabeat take a 357 battery or a modern AG 13/LR 44 battery.
Like Electric watches, Timex Dynabeat have a hybrid quartz-mechanical movement, using quartz battery to power a mechanical watch in place of a wound mainspring.
Dynabeat watches include the Time-Zone, Timex’s first GMT watch produced in the 1970s.
